Worship Devotional for 9/12/21 

We've been singing lately about the joy of the Lord, but we know that this life is filled with much sorrow and heartache. The joy of the Lord carries us through such times, but there will be seasons in our lives when we don't feel joyful. Even as believers — the children of God who have been given life and hope and peace and joy that is eternal in Christ Jesus our Lord, through whom we have been reconciled to the One who is the source of all goodness and love and truth — we still sometimes battle with depression and grief and doubt and fear. We still struggle with our sin and weakness and with the deception and darkness that has a hold on the world around us. This week is about holding onto faith when things are difficult and painful. We are singing about still believing and trusting in the Lord even when things don't make sense and everything seems to be crashing and falling apart around or within us. We must remember that we are not alone. We all must face various struggles in this life, but God's love and faithfulness and goodness remain steadfast and true through it all. When sorrows weigh heavily upon our souls, may we be able to say along with the sons of Korah, who wrote Psalms 42 and 43:

"Why am I so depressed? Why this turmoil within me? Put your hope in God, for I will still praise Him, my Savior and my God" (Ps. 42:5, 42:11, & 43:5).

  1) Breakthrough by Red Rocks Worship  

Maybe you're struggling with a recent event, and you know that the struggle will fade, but it's extremely difficult right now. Maybe you are struggling with a vice that you've had for years and you just can't seem to find victory even though you've wrestled and tried hard to fight it. Maybe the struggles of others or of the world in general are just weighing heavily on you. Whatever your struggle, you may wonder if there will ever be breakthrough. Will there ever come a time when you finally overcome and find relief from the suffering? Sometimes breakthrough comes almost immediately when we turn our hearts to the Lord. But sometimes it only comes after a long time of waiting and praying. For some things, it may not ever come at all in this life. It may not come on our time, but we know and have come to believe that there is nothing and no one greater than our God. Because we have this hope that goes beyond this life in the One who is greater than all, we can believe with confidence even through the hardest times that there will be breakthrough. The power and presence of God is able to break the strongholds in our lives that keep us from growing closer to Him. So take whatever you're dealing with right now and give it to the Lord in prayer. Call out to Him who loves us and hears us, and hold onto faith. 

  2) Lord From Sorrows Deep I Call by Matt Papa and Matt Boswell  

The sorrows of this life can run very deep. But even in that place of hurting and desperation, the Lord is near. Cry out to Him from your pain and sorrow, for He hears you and loves you. He may not take away the pain, but He will be with you to comfort and strengthen you and to provide you with what you need. He does not act according to our will, but He is always faithful to keep His promises. So turn your heart to His word and trust in what He has said when things are hard and confusing and uncertain. He is our help and the rock of our salvation, and He is worthy of our praise at all times. 

Psalm 34:18:

"The Lord is near the brokenhearted; He saves those crushed in spirit."

  4) Way Maker by Osinachi Kalu Okoro Egbu  

We don't just worship God when things are good and everything seems to be going well. We must also come before Him and surrender our hearts to His eternal greatness when things are at their worst. He is with us as He promised, and He is at work among us. He is able to make a way for breakthrough, victory, healing, and restoration even and especially when there seems to be no way. He is the Way Maker, Promise Keeper, Miracle Worker, Light in the darkness. He is moving and working in and around us even when we don't feel it or see it. So hold onto faith in the true and living God, no matter what you go through in this life. He is worthy of praise, and He is faithful to deliver us.
